Exploring Self-Expression: Noah Cyrus' Controversial Desert Photoshoot

Noah Cyrus recently shared a desert photoshoot on social media, featuring a revealing black bodysuit and dramatic poses. The images sparked mixed reactions, with some praising the artistic vision while others criticized the outfit and styling. Noah, who has spoken about struggling with body dysmorphia, did not provide an explanation for the photoshoot, which featured her in sheer tights and a black thong bodysuit with a wraparound top. Some social media users compared the photos to Lady Gaga's "Perfect Illusion" and questioned the attention-seeking nature of the shoot.
The photos showcased Noah's tattoos and dark aesthetic, with one image showing her pulling aside the outfit to cover her exposed breast with her hand. Another photo captured her from behind, revealing her back and the thong-style outfit. Noah quoted lyrics from a song in the caption but did not elaborate on the meaning behind the photoshoot. The singer has faced criticism in the past for her fashion choices and social media posts, including a childhood photo from her "Hannah Montana" days and plastic surgery rumors.
Noah has opened up about feeling unhappy with herself and facing constant comparisons to her famous family, particularly her sister Miley Cyrus. She has also discussed the impact of online criticism on her self-esteem and body image.
